Leeds United owner Andrea Radrizzani has welcomed Indonesian tycoon Erick Thohir to Elland Road on Twitter after striking up an intriguing partnership.

Former Inter Milan owner and president Thohir  – founder of media company Mahaka Group – joined the board of League One strugglers Oxford United earlier this month after severing his ties with the Italian giants.

The businessman uploaded an image on his Instagram account that showed him holding aloft a Leeds shirt with Radrizzani, who sent a message to him on his personal Twitter account saying “looking forward to have you at Elland Road next year”.

Mystery surrounds the partnership struck up between Thohir and Radrizzani. Has the Leeds owner agreed to sell a stake in the Yorkshire giants to the Indonesian multi-millionaire? Or have they settled another business arrangement that could benefit Leeds? Or, perhaps Oxford – where Thohir joined the board on 8 November – have merely been invited to Elland Road for a pre-season friendly? Certainly, they won’t be heading to the stadium to play a competitive match next year as they are marooned in 20th in League One, while United are setting their sights on promotion from the Championship. Thohir is a well-connected businessman with fingers in plenty of sporting pies. He owns Major League Soccer club DC United, where Wayne Rooney is dazzling following his summer move, and had a stake in basketball side Philadelphia 76ers. He was also the majority shareholder of Inter for five years before leaving the board last month. Some clarity from Radrizzani and Thohir might be useful.
